IDR is seeking a Critical Operations Engineer II to join one of our top clients for an opportunity in Secaucus, NJ. This role is ideal for professionals with a strong background in facilities and critical systems operations. The company operates within the industrial and data center sectors, focusing on maintaining large-scale mechanical, electrical, and control systems essential for operational continuity.

Position Overview for the Critical Operations Engineer II:
  • Install, maintain, and troubleshoot large commercial and industrial systems including chilled water systems, HVAC equipment, VFDs, pumps, and electrical distribution.
  • Diagnose and repair critical systems such as generators, switchgear, UPS, and fiber cabling infrastructure.
  • Lead and execute fiber and copper cabling projects, ensuring industry standards and safety protocols are met.
  • Use trending, analysis, and integrated monitoring systems to track system performance and troubleshoot issues effectively.
  • Demonstrate strong leadership and communication skills within a team environment to support facility operations.

Requirements for the Critical Operations Engineer II:
  • Minimum of 5-7 years of experience installing, maintaining, and troubleshooting large commercial and industrial systems.
  • Proven expertise in fiber optics/cabling infrastructure and troubleshooting IT hardware, servers, and network switches.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and oral, including proficiency with Microsoft Suite.
  • Comprehensive understanding of electrical and mechanical systems used in facilities and data center environments.
  • Expert knowledge of NEC, NFPA codes, OSHA standards, and industry best practices for safety and compliance.
